問題タブ [android-videoview]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Android VideoView LinearLayout LayoutParams
私のアプリは、VideoView を使用してビデオを再生します。私は LinearLayout を使用して、いくつかのテキスト、ビデオ、そしていくつかのボタンを追加しています。
私の質問は、VideoView がすべての電話で適切に再生されるようにするために、どのようなレイアウト パラメータを使用できるかということです。基本的に、ポートレート モードの場合は、幅全体を使用し、ビデオの高さを使用する必要があります。横向きのときは、フルスクリーンモードのように見せたいです。
この設定は、縦向きと横向きの両方の myTouch でうまく機能することに気付きました。
new LinearLayout.LayoutParams( LayoutParams.FILL_PARENT,480);
そして、これはDroidで縦向きと横向きの両方で機能します。
new LinearLayout.LayoutParams( LayoutParams.FILL_PARENT, LayoutParams.WRAP_CONTENT);
ありがとうクリス
android - Android -- RelativeLayout と LinearLayout -- VideoView のサイズ変更の問題
ビデオのサイズ変更に問題があります。プログラムでレイアウトを作成する必要があります。コードは次のとおりです。
ルート レイアウトは相対レイアウトです。myText は、ルート レイアウトの上部に追加する Textview です。次に、myText の下に VideoView を追加します。ルート レイアウトの下部に、いくつかのボタンを追加します。
myVideo は、以下のように定義された LinearLayout です。
縦向きモードでは、ビデオが中央に表示され、ビデオが幅全体と適切な高さを占めます。横向きモードでは、ビデオが画面全体を占め (これが私の望みです)、myText はまったく表示されません。
ありがとうクリス
android - Androidで動画を再生するには?
ビデオが res/raw フォルダに配置されている場合、Android アプリケーションでビデオを再生するにはどうすればよいですか?
android - TextView と VideoView
LinearLayout 内に TextView があり、LinearLayout 内に VideoView があります。
親レイアウトは、TextView の線形レイアウトと VideoView の線形レイアウトを含む RelativeLayout です。
FILL_PARENT、FILL_PARENTパラメーターを使用してVideoViewを追加するため(横向きモードで画面を埋めたいので)、一部の電話では横向きに回転するとVideoViewが画面全体を埋め、TextViewは表示されません。
これは、特定の携帯電話でのみ、横向きモードでのみ発生します。
VideoView の線形レイアウトの上部パディングを設定しようとしましたが、携帯電話ごとにパディングが異なるようです。例: 10 の上部パディングは myTouch では機能しますが、Droid では機能しません。
何か案は?
ありがとうクリス
android - すぐに再生せずにVideoViewにビデオをロードするだけ
Androidで、VideoView
すぐに再生を開始せずにビデオデータをにロードすることは可能ですか?もしそうなら、どうすればそれを行うことができますか?
android - AndroidVideoView横向きの問題
私はAndroidとモバイル開発全般にかなり慣れていません。ボタンを選択した後、VideoViewを使用してビデオを再生するAndroidアプリケーションを作成しています。問題は、電話を回転させるとビデオが再起動することです。回転するとアクティビティが破棄されて再作成されるため、私はそれを知っています。だから私はちょうど横向きのビューでビデオプレーヤーをロックしました。ただし、デフォルトでは、電話を正しく表示するには、電話を左(右側を上)に傾ける必要があります。もう1つの方法は、ビデオを逆さまに表示するだけです。
ユーザーが電話を右(左側を上)に傾けた場合にビデオを正しく表示する方法はありますか?ご入力いただきありがとうございます。
android - android videoview - 悪いURLエラーの管理?
インターネットからビデオを視聴するために期限切れのURLを使用しているため、有効期限が切れるとビデオが機能しなくなります。この場合、ビデオが読めないというエラー ダイアログ ボックスがビデオ プレーヤーから表示されます。それは結構ですが、独自のダイアログ ボックスのテキストを表示したいと思います。どのようにできるのか ?ビデオが機能しなかったことを知る方法はありますか? 何か案は ?
android - ビデオの再生時に ViewFlipper の VideoView が透明になる
ViewFlipper に 2 つのビューが設定された Activity があります。ビューの 1 つは GLSurfaceView と他のいくつかのウィジェットを含むレイアウトで、もう 1 つは TextView と VideoView を含むレイアウトです。GLSurfaceView で何かをクリックすると、ViewFlipper が切り替わり、ビデオを再生できるようになります。このスクリーンショットでは、左側にマップをレンダリングするプレーンな GLSurfaceView が表示されます。右側は、ViewFlipper が反転してビデオの再生が開始された後の様子です。
GLSurfaceView が透けて見える空の透明な領域は、ビデオがあるはずの場所です。スピーカーから再生が聞こえ、タイムラインが進んでいるので、再生されていることがわかります。
必要に応じてコードを投稿できますが、かなり複雑になる可能性があります。
ここで何が起こっているかについてのアイデアはありますか?
android - VideoView にペイントする
VideoView で実行中のビデオにフリーハンドでペイント (フィンガー ペイント) できるアプリをコーディングしようとしています。私は2つのことを別々に実行していますが、一緒には実行していません。空白の画面にペイントを描画でき、xml レイアウトで実装されている videoView でビデオを再生できます。
xml videoview ビューを、描画可能な他のビューでオーバーレイする方法はありますか?
android - アセットまたは raw フォルダーからビデオを再生したい
Android のアプリでアセットまたは raw フォルダーからビデオを再生したいのですが、ビデオをVideoView
再生できないため、エラーが発生します。解決策を教えてください。
これが私が使用したコードです